Common DoorKing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Davis
- Greenbelt hinge failure on DoorKing 1800 series. Davis’s city-mandated greenbelt easements behind homes in 95616 and 95618 put rear pedestrian gates through 10–20 daily cycles from bike and foot traffic. The hinge pins oval out, strike plates drift, and the 1800’s limit switches start phantom-reversing because the gate never hits the same closed position twice. We replace with heavy-duty stainless hinges and recalibrate.
- Summer track binding on DoorKing 6300 slide gates. West-facing driveways in Davis hit 100–108 °F for weeks straight, expanding steel track until rollers seize. The 6300’s motor overheats, throws thermal shutdown codes, and homeowners assume the operator’s failed. Usually it’s a 3/16-inch track misalignment we can correct and reinforce.
- Tule fog corrosion on DoorKing 1838 control terminals. Winter ground fog sits on Davis’s valley floor for weeks, wicking moisture into board terminals that read “No Power” or throw random faults. We clean, seal, and replace with corrosion-resistant connectors—often saving a $400+ board replacement.
- Clay soil heave misaligning DoorKing 6100 posts. Davis’s expansive clay shifts with winter moisture and summer desiccation, tilting gate posts until the 6100’s latch and operator fight each other. The gear teeth strip. We realign posts, reset operators, and weld reinforcement gussets in-house.
- Deferred maintenance on rental gates near UC Davis. Student rentals cycle tenants every 9–12 months with zero gate upkeep. Corroded latches, heaved posts, and stripped operators accumulate until the gate won’t secure the property. We diagnose the full chain of failure and quote repair-versus-replacement honestly.
DoorKing Service in Davis: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Davis’s signature greenbelt and bicycle-path network runs behind residential blocks throughout the 95616 and 95618 ZIP codes, and that single design choice reshapes everything about how DoorKing gates wear out here. A rear pedestrian gate opening onto a high-traffic greenway gets opened and closed more times before lunch than most suburban front gates manage in a week. The DoorKing 1800 series operators on these gates are spec’d for residential duty cycles, not commuter-path volume. Hinge pins wear oval within 18–24 months. Strike plates drift 3/8-inch or more. The operator’s limit switches, constantly hunting for a consistent closed position, start drifting too—producing that maddening “reverses halfway” symptom that sends Davis homeowners searching for “DoorKing repair near me.”
On a recent call near the greenbelt off Miller Drive in the 95616 ZIP, our crew found a DoorKing 1800 swing operator on a rear pedestrian gate that was cycling 30+ times a day from bike path traffic. The hinge pin had worn oval, the strike plate was 3/8-inch out of alignment, and the motor limit switches were drifting—we replaced the corroded hinge set with heavy-duty stainless units, realigned the strike, and recalibrated the limits, restoring smooth operation without replacing the whole operator. That’s the pattern we see across Davis: greenbelt-side gates destroyed by use, front vehicle gates pristine by comparison. If your rear gate is the problem child, there’s a reason, and it’s not the operator’s fault.

DoorKing Service Pricing in Davis
Most DoorKing repairs in Davis fall between these ranges:
- Hinge/latch adjustment or replacement: $180–$290
- Limit switch recalibration or sensor realignment: $150–$220
- Control board diagnosis and repair: $260–$420
- Operator motor replacement (OEM): $340–$520
- Post realignment with welding reinforcement: $280–$450
- Full operator replacement (1800/6100/6300 series): $1,200–$2,400 depending on gate size and access
What drives cost: parts (OEM vs. aftermarket, which we discuss openly), labor time (welding adds 1–2 hours but prevents repeat failure), and access (greenbelt gates with no driveway clearance take longer to service).
